Wagner Lands in Brooklyn | Brooklyn Nets News
Description
The Brooklyn Nets just pulled off a savvy move, signing Moe Wagner to a two-year, $19M deal that slashes their cap space to $25M. With a mutual option for Year 2 ($9M), Wagner’s future hangs in the balance — but either way, he brings much-needed toughness and center depth to a roster that desperately needed it. At 6’11”, 28, and a seasoned vet, Wagner’s arrival fills a void left by Day’Ron Sharpe’s lone center role. Despite earning less than $7 ppg in his final Magic season due to injury, Wagner’s loyalty to Brooklyn runs deep — he’s been a fan since 2018, wore Nets gear, and even preferred them over the Knicks. Plus, rumors say he’s been hanging out in Brooklyn all summer with his girlfriend. This isn’t just a contract — it’s a statement.
